OCFC dividend history
Dividends per share by year
| Year | Total per share | Payments |
|---|---|---|
| 2026 (year to date) | USD0.600 | 3 |
| 2025 | USD0.800 | 4 |
| 2024 | USD0.800 | 4 |
| 2023 | USD0.800 | 4 |
| 2022 | USD0.740 | 4 |
| 2021 | USD0.680 | 4 |
| 2020 | USD0.680 | 4 |
| 2019 | USD0.680 | 4 |
| 2018 | USD0.620 | 4 |
| 2017 | USD0.600 | 4 |
| 2016 | USD0.540 | 4 |
Split-adjusted amounts in the listing currency, grouped by the calendar year of the ex-dividend date, from the filed record. Growth and streak figures compare complete years only.

About OceanFirst Financial Corp.
OceanFirst Financial Corp. operates as the bank holding company for OceanFirst Bank N.A. that provides community banking services to retail and commercial customers in the United States. The company accepts deposit products, such as money market accounts, savings accounts, interest-bearing checking accounts, non-interest-bearing accounts, and time deposits, including brokered deposits. It also offers commercial real estate, multi-family, land loans, construction, and commercial and industrial loans; fixed-rate and adjustable-rate mortgage loans that are secured by one-to-four family residences; and consumer loans, such as home equity loans and lines of credit, student loans, loans on savings accounts, overdraft line of credit, and other consumer loans. In addition, the company invests in mortgage-backed securities, securities issued by the U.S. government and agencies, corporate securities, and other investments; and provides bankcard services, trust and asset management products and services, deposit account services, sales of loans and investments, bank owned life insurance and commercial loan swap income. The company was founded in 1902 and is headquartered in Toms River, New Jersey.

A word of warning on reading these figures: a 13F reports the market value of a holding, so a fund that traded nothing at all still appears to have sold when the price fell. We found 102 companies where the standard reading gives the opposite answer. Only the share count is honest.
